Confirmed that Jeremy Kylie will sit in for Piers from 1 August to 5 September:

https://www.news.co.uk/2022/07/jeremy-ky...ss-august/

Quote:Broadcaster Jeremy Kyle will host TalkTV’s primetime Piers Morgan Uncensored through August, as the eponymous host takes time out to film a new series of his true crime documentaries and take a well-earned vacation.

Jeremy takes the reins of the Piers Morgan Uncensored show from Monday, 1st August and will host the show, which is broadcast on TalkTV in the UK, Fox Nation in the US and on Sky News Australia, for the following five weeks. Piers will return to the show on Monday, 5th September.

Kate McCann has written about this week's incident for The Sunday Times:

https://www.thetimes.co.uk/article/i-fel...-nvgc8lbtw

Quote:The last thing I remember is thinking “this next question is going to be the one” and for the first time in 30 minutes of debate, allowing myself to relax. Then suddenly my body wasn’t where it was supposed to be and someone I couldn’t see was asking me my age.

I couldn’t work out why anyone would need to know that in the middle of a discussion about Ukraine and I remember thinking how rude it was for either candidate to ask.

Then came the creeping sense of panic as my brain started to catch up with my body, which wasn’t at the lectern facing Liz Truss and Rishi Sunak, the Conservative leadership candidates, but on the floor of a television studio surrounded by faces I didn’t recognise.
